At Loch, after a short pitstop for morning tea, leave the mainstream roads to head south towards Wonthaggi to tackle some 3rd gear twisties along what seems to be an endless ridge top with magnificent views of the surrounding hills. As we approach Wonthaggi, we'll see the huge wind turbines in the distance like something straight out of science fiction movie. Then we'll do some nice coastal bends along the Bunurong Coastal Road (and in my best Clarkson-style "Some say it's like a mini Great Ocean Road") with blue ocean views to the right before arriving for our lunch pitstop at Inverloch. After a fulfilling lunch, we continue on some more less-travelled winding roads to scenic Walkerville South with its wierd sea-carved rock formations just off the beach. After a brief photo opp, we head off to the place this cruise is all about - the world famous and spectacular Wilsons Prom National Park. After passing the entrance gate to the park, there are challenging hill climbs and twisties that will keep your hands busy, and awesome views of the deep blue ocean and crashing waves as we roar towards the park ranger's headquarters at Tidal River. Here, you'll have rest time - sit on the beach, go for a short walk, kick the footy, breath in the fresh sea air, re-energise or become one with nature. After about an hour or so, we'll head home more directly via the South Gippsland Highway, with a short detour near Korumburra to avoid the unsealed gravel VicRoad road works between Loch and Korumburra.DURATION: Approximately 9 hours including lunch and rest stops (about 460km round-trip).There will be plenty of pitstops because this cruise is a long one.
